aNgeLxfOrEvEr answered Wednesday January 12 2005, 1:02 pm: Cartilidge is at the top part of your ear (like the corner). I got mine pierced almost 7 months ago. It hurts more than a regular earlobe piercing, but that's just because it's in the cartilidge part. When I got mine done, it only hurt the second they did it. Then I walked around and it felt fine. The only thing is--it hurts when you are sleeping because you are putting your weight on the top of your ear. So I suggest getting the ear pierced that you <b>don't</b> sleep on. It will hurt less. Also, I would recommend not getting it at Claires. They aren't that great. Try to look around in your mall or a tattoo/piercing place around you. As for the prices: I got mine done at a place where you just pay for the earring and they'll pierce it for you. But it's different at all places and it depends on what kind of earring you get.
